Why do you think the Bible is clear on this matter? ...

54 - And when he was come into his own country, he taught them in their synagogue, insomuch that they were astonished, and said, Whence hath this man this wisdom, and these mighty works?

55 - Is not this the carpenter's son? is not his mother called Mary? and his brethren, James, and Joses, and Simon, and Judas?

56 - And his sisters, are they not all with us? Whence then hath this man all these things?

-- Matthew Chap 13

All the Jews though Jesus was the son of Joseph ... even His own family ... we need to keep reading:

57 - And they were offended in him. But Jesus said unto them, A prophet is not without honor, save in his own country, and in his own house.

58 - And he did not many mighty works there because of their unbelief.

Clarity is provided in The Protevangelion ...

12 - And the high priest said, Joseph, Thou art the person chosen to take the Virgin of the Lord, to keep her for Him.

13 - But Joseph refused, saying, I am an old man, and have children, but she is young, and I fear lest I should appear ridiculous in Israel.

-- Protevangelion Chap 8

As I stated in a prior post ... this material is legendary ... and considered apocryphal by Western Churches ... however, the Bible doesn't explicitly state Mary bore more children after Jesus, only that Jesus had brothers ... one tradition keeps this as Jesus' half-brothers and sisters ...
